Intended Uses: This sandwich kit is for the accurate quantitative detection of Rat Microtubule-associated Protein 2 (also known as MAP-2) in serum, plasma, cell culture supernates, cell lysates, tissue homogenates.
Principle of the Assay: This kit is an Enzyme-Linked Immunosorbent Assay (ELISA). The plate has been pre-coated with Rat MAP-2 antibody. MAP-2 present in the sample is added and binds to antibodies coated on the wells. And then biotinylated Rat MAP-2 Antibody is added and binds to MAP-2 in the sample. Then Streptavidin-HRP is added and binds to the Biotinylated MAP-2 antibody. After incubation unbound Streptavidin-HRP is washed away during a washing step. Substrate solution is then added and color develops in proportion to the amount of Rat MAP-2. The reaction is terminated by addition of acidic stop solution and absorbance is measured at 450 nm
